Hatton & Lowry Address Recent PGA Tour Player Behavior: Concerns Over Pace of Play and On-Course Demeanor
The PGA Tour has seen its fair share of on-course controversies recently, prompting outspoken players like Tyrrell Hatton and Shane Lowry to address the growing concerns surrounding player behavior. From slow play to perceived displays of poor sportsmanship, the issue has sparked debate amongst players, fans, and commentators alike. This article delves into the comments made by Hatton and Lowry, examining the underlying issues and potential solutions to restore decorum and improve the overall viewing experience.
Hatton's Frustration with Slow Play
Tyrrell Hatton, known for his passionate, sometimes fiery, on-course demeanor, has been vocal about his frustration with the pace of play on the PGA Tour. In recent interviews, he hasn't minced words, expressing his belief that some players are taking excessive time between shots, disrupting the flow of the game and impacting the overall viewing experience. He highlighted the importance of respecting the time constraints and the need for players to maintain a reasonable pace, suggesting that stricter enforcement of existing rules might be necessary. This isn't a new issue; slow play has plagued professional golf for years, but Hatton's outspoken criticism has brought it back into the spotlight. He advocates for a more proactive approach, perhaps implementing stricter penalties or employing more visible on-course officials to monitor play more effectively.
Lowry's Emphasis on Sportsmanship and Respect
Shane Lowry, a respected veteran on the Tour, took a slightly different approach, emphasizing the importance of sportsmanship and respect for fellow players, caddies, and fans. While acknowledging the issue of slow play, Lowry focused more broadly on the overall conduct and behavior exhibited on the course. He stressed the responsibility players have to uphold the integrity of the game and set a positive example for aspiring golfers. His comments suggest a need for a more holistic approach, addressing not only the pace of play but also instances of poor etiquette or unsportsmanlike conduct, such as shouting or excessive celebration. Lowry’s perspective offers a valuable counterpoint, reminding us that the issues extend beyond simple time management.
